When faced with a singular ingredient in your kitchen, the possibilities for culinary exploration are endless. From versatile vegetables to pantry staples, here's a guide to transforming a single ingredient into a diverse array of delicious dishes.
1. Avocado:
Guacamole with a Twist:
- Mash avocados and add unexpected ingredients like pomegranate seeds, feta cheese, or diced mango for a unique and refreshing guacamole.

7. Eggs:
Cloud Eggs:
Separate egg whites and yolks, beat the whites until stiff, then bake with the yolks nestled in the clouds. A visually stunning and delicious breakfast option.
Shakshuka:
Poach eggs in a spicy tomato and bell pepper sauce for a flavorful and comforting Middle Eastern dish. Serve with crusty bread for dipping.
Egg Fried Rice:
Transform leftover rice into a quick and tasty meal by stir-frying with vegetables, soy sauce, and scrambled eggs.
